Output 2168136ebcd31255ca6db4a691bc735bbf3347dae60ae5fd26cfe065ca57047e:3

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d58d2dbfd5636b4db28697238b1fc3d762df84f8 OP_EQUAL
address
3MAAyfwjnWv8H2znN55NTjyFhbJXj1umyQ
transaction
2168136ebcd31255ca6db4a691bc735bbf3347dae60ae5fd26cfe065ca57047e
confirmations
292029
spent
true